Ingredients:
4 1/2 ounces butter
4 1/2 ounces sugar
5 eggs
1 cup of milk
2 ounces yeast
10 ounces of flour
Preparation:
- Mix 4 1/2 ounces butter with an equal amount of sugar, add 5 eggs well beaten, 1 cup of milk, 2 ounces yeast, and 10 ounces of flour.
- Let it rise for 2 hours, form into shape of a large fleur-de-lis, or 3-pointed flower (to represent the Trinity), ice with sugar, and bake 1 hour.
